B. officers-elect. Leading Duncan High students in honors for the year were MELODY JONES, valedictorian; and KIRK HOOPER, salutatorian. Both received other honors. Melody won scholar- ships on both county and state levels in the Elks Most Valuable Student compe- tition; a tuition waiver at Arizona State University, a four-year scholarship to Brigham Young University, the Joseph Lehman Scholarship, and a Future Homemakers of America scholarship. Kirk won an Elks Club MVS scholar- ship and PTA and University of Arizona scholarships. Both received awards as outstanding music students. flowers and gifts Crowns began to go out of style, but not flowers and gifts, or sweaters and jackets, which favorites received during the year. For Homecoming, sponsored by the student council, the classes chose princes and prin- cesses as attendants to the senior royalty, and the cheerleaders and twirlers ushered each couple down the field, where at halftime of the Clifton game, preceding year's royalty—Billie Lackey and Sam Martinez— crowned Kimmie Cox and Armando Rendon. Senior runners-up were Norma Crockett, Darla Cox, Sue Ellen Shreve, Bill Cuthbertson, Dale Howard, and Hugh Nichols. At the Christmas Ball the seniors honored Melody Jones and Russ Richins as their queen and king; attendants were Patsy Quinones, Peggy Claridge, Jerry Pena, and Brad Boyd. In the spring, the FFA, FHA, and GAC elected favored ones. First, at a joint FHA- FFA dance, FHA President Melody Jones present- a sweater and a bracelet to Beau Don Pena. Runners-up were Adam Luna and Harold Hille. Then, at the GAC-sponsored volleyball game in April, President Kimmie Cox helped Beau Richard Wright into a GAC jacket. As a highlight of the FFA Banquet April 22, Wyla Hooper, Karen Fitzhugh, and Renada York received FFA jackets, Wyla being the Sweetheart for 1976-1977; and Karen and Renada her ladies-in-waiting. Finally, at the Junior-Senior Prom in late April, Julie Dozier and Bill Cuth- bertson were proclaimed queen and king. Attending royalty were Norma Crockett, Peggy Claridge, Alice Thygerson, Dale Howard, Jim Crotts, and Kirk Hooper. Queen Julie, Left; juniors' president Adam Luna, Far Right.
